Seychelles vs. Puerto Rico: The Sovereign Sanctuary vs. The Vibrant US Territory

A Tale of Two Islands: An Independent Jewel vs. a Caribbean-American Fusion

Comparing Seychelles and Puerto Rico is to contrast a sovereign, tranquil escape with a vibrant, complex island that exists at the unique intersection of Caribbean and American cultures. Seychelles is an independent nation in the Indian Ocean, a master of serene, exclusive paradise. Puerto Rico, a territory of the United States, is a "rich port" of immense cultural energy, historical depth, and a dynamic, if sometimes challenging, blend of two identities.

The Most Striking Contrasts

  • Political Status: This is the fundamental difference. Seychelles is a fully independent republic. Puerto Rico is an unincorporated territory of the U.S., meaning its residents are US citizens but have no voting representation in Congress and do not vote in presidential elections. This status shapes its economy, politics, and identity.
  • The Vibe: Seychelles is calm, quiet, and elegantly reserved. Puerto Rico is loud, proud, and full of "sazón" (flavor/spice). It’s a place of vibrant street art, pulsing salsa and reggaeton music, and a passionate, expressive culture.
  • Economic Landscape: Seychelles has a focused economy on high-end tourism and finance. Puerto Rico has a complex economy deeply integrated with the United States, with strong sectors in pharmaceuticals and manufacturing, alongside a massive tourism industry that ranges from luxury resorts to cruise ship ports.
  • The Infrastructure: Life in Seychelles feels remote and self-contained. In Puerto Rico, the American influence is visible in its highways, shopping malls, and familiar US franchises, which exist alongside a distinctly Caribbean way of life.

The Paradox of Independence vs. Interdependence

Seychelles has forged its identity and success through its complete independence, allowing it to create a unique, self-contained world. Puerto Rico’s identity is forged in its interdependence with the United States. This relationship provides economic and travel benefits (like using the US dollar and no passport required for Americans) but also creates a continuous, passionate debate about the island's political future and cultural identity.

The Tourist Experience

A Seychelles holiday is a quiet beach retreat. A Puerto Rican holiday is a journey of variety. You can explore the 500-year-old cobblestone streets of Old San Juan, hike in the El Yunque tropical rainforest (the only one in the U.S. National Forest System), kayak in a bioluminescent bay, and enjoy a world-class food and cocktail scene.

💡 Surprising Fact

Puerto Rico is home to the Arecibo Observatory, which for over 50 years housed the world's largest single-aperture radio telescope, a vital tool for astronomical research until its collapse in 2020. The island also has three of the world's five brightest bioluminescent bays, where microorganisms in the water glow when agitated, creating a magical, starry night in the sea.
